Abstract
Using controlled pore glass chromatography and immunoaffinity chromatography on monoclonal antibodies NK-2 immobilized on Sepharose 4B, the electrophoretically homogeneous interferons αN and αI1 were isolated from the biomass of gene-engineered Pseudomonas sp. strains. In terms of specific activity on human fibrolast diploid cells, interferon αI1 does not differ from interferon αA, whereas the specific antiviral activity of interferon αN is as low as 2·107 JU/mg. The procedures for immunometric assay of interferons αN and αI1 have been elaborated. Various monoclonal antibodies to interferon αA and to natural leucocyte interferon were analyzed; among those the antibodies specifically interacting with interferons αN and αI1 (but not with interferon αA) were identified.
